What Is High Anxiety?
High anxiety describes an unmanageable and excessive state of concern or fear that disrupts daily activities. This state often transcends normal anxiety levels and can impact both psychological and physical health. Anxiety conditions consist of generalized anxiety condition (GAD), panic attack, social anxiety condition, and specific phobias, to name a few.
Symptoms of High Anxiety
The symptoms of high anxiety can manifest in different methods, affecting both the mind and body. Below is an extensive table laying out the common psychological and physical symptoms related to high anxiety.

Recognizing the symptoms of high anxiety is the initial step towards looking for aid or executing management methods. Here are some typical methods anxiety may manifest:

Cognitive Symptoms:
Excessive Worrying: Individuals may find themselves unable to stop fretting about various elements of their lives, even situations that do not necessitate such concern.Trouble Concentrating: Anxiety can cloud judgment and diminish focus, making it challenging to complete tasks or talk.Fear of Losing Control: Individuals may have relentless thoughts about impending doom or losing control in public or personal circumstances.
Psychological Symptoms:
Irritability: High anxiety often results in increased aggravation and irritability, affecting relationships with others.Feeling Overwhelmed: Individuals might feel that their obligations are more than they can deal with, resulting in avoidance behavior.
Physical Symptoms:

High anxiety can be triggered by various factors, consisting of biological, environmental, and mental influences. Comprehending these causes can help in handling anxiety better.
Biological Factors: Genetics can play a role in the predisposition towards anxiety conditions. Handling high anxiety involves a holistic approach that includes lifestyle modifications, therapeutic interventions, and possibly medication. Below are some effective techniques:

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T):
CBT is a structured program that assists people recognize and alter negative thought patterns and habits contributing to anxiety.
Mindfulness and Relaxation Techniques:
Practicing mindfulness through meditation, yoga, or deep-breathing workouts can assist ground people and minimize sensations of anxiety.
Exercise:
Regular exercise is known to launch endorphins, which can assist reduce anxiety and improve state of mind.
Well balanced Diet:
Nutrition can affect psychological health; a well-balanced diet plan that includes omega-3 fats, vitamins, and minerals can support total well-being.
Social Support:
Connecting with friends, family, or support system can produce a sense of belonging and minimize sensations of isolation.
Medication:

Can high anxiety lead to physical health issue?
Yes, chronic anxiety can lead to physical health issues, including high blood pressure, cardiovascular disease, digestive issues, and chronic pain conditions.
Is it possible to handle anxiety without medication?
Yes, numerous individuals find relief through therapy, lifestyle modifications, and natural remedies. It's important to speak with a healthcare provider for personalized recommendations.
How can I support a loved one with high anxiety?
Using psychological support, encouraging them to look for professional help, and actively listening without judgment can make a considerable distinction in their journey.
